Monetising B2B is a (now sold-out) one-day conference organised by Flashes & Flames to focus on the future challenges and opportunities of business information and events.
Hosted at the historic Stationers’ Hall, near St Paul’s Cathedral in London, the event features interviews, panel discussions and networking with leaders and operators from many of the world’s most innovative B2B companies. It’s a day built around insights, ideas, innovation conversations and peer-to-peer connections. An experience built for learning and connections.
Doors open at 8 am, and the speaker programme starts at 8:45 am. The programme ends at 4:30 pm, after which delegates are invited to join us for drinks and canapés, sponsored by Simon-Kucher, from 4.30pm–6.00pm.
Monetising B2B is organised by Colin Morrison CBE, Founder of Flashes & Flames: The Global Media Business Weekly and produced by Cobus Heyl of That Coalition.
AGENDA:
Here is the complete agenda for Monetising B2B.
8.00 (45 min) – Registration and breakfast networking
8.45 (30 min) – How RELX transformed the world’s largest B2B magazine group into a global data business
Mark Kelsey, CEO, Lexis-Nexis Risk Solutions – Interviewed by Colin Morrison
9.15 (20 min) – How we became the TripAdvisor for scientists
Kerry Parker, CEO, SelectScience – Interviewed by Natasha Christie-Miller
9.35 (20 min) – How the Business of Fashion upstaged the legends
Nick Blunden, President, The Business of Fashion – Interviewed by Natasha Christie-Miller
9.55 (45 min) – How (and why) events are changing
Panel: Lisa Hannant (Clarion Events), Greg Hitchen (Terrapinn), Paul Miller (Questex)
Moderator: Colin Morrison
10.40 (30 min) – Coffee and networking
11.10 (40 min) – How proprietary data can transform B2B values
Panel: Neil Bradford (General Index), Charlie Kerr (With Intelligence), Leon Saunders Calvert (Economist Intelligence), Mariana Valle (Insurance Insider)
Moderator: Rory Brown
11.50 (30 min) – The 21st Century lessons of B2B information and events
Hugh Jones, CEO, RX (Reed Exhibitions) – Interviewed by Colin Morrison
12.20 (25 min) – What’s so special about the Cannes Lions brand?
Simon Cook, CEO, Cannes Lions Group – Interviewed by Colin Morrison
12.45 (60 min) – Lunch and networking
1.45 (25 min) – How William Reed went from UK print to international events and data company
Tracy De Groose, CEO, William Reed Group – Interviewed by Colin Morrison
2.10 (40 min) – How AI can generate real profit
Session introduction: Jennifer Schivas-Porter, CEO, 67 Bricks

Panel: Adriana Whiteley (FT Strategies), Amir Malik (Alvarez & Marsal)
Moderator: Paul Hood
2.50 (30 min) – Coffee and networking
3.20 (25 min) – The Accidental Entrepreneur
Mark Allen, Chair-Founder, Mark Allen Group – Interviewed by Colin Morrison
3.45 (30 min) – How my curiosity became a membership-based business
William Jefferson Black, Chair and co-founder, Transaction Advisors Institute – Interviewed by Colin Morrison
4.15 (15 min) – The Flashes & Flames Top 20: Takeaways from the day
Colin Morrison, Founder, Flashes & Flames
4.30–6.00 (90 min) – Drinks Reception, Sponsored by Simon-Kucher
Canapés, catch-up and wind-down around the corner from Stationers' Hall at Fleet's St Paul's, 44-46 Ludgate Hill, London, EC4M 7DE

VENUE:
'Monetising B2B' takes place on Tuesday 20 May 2025 at Stationers' Hall, in Central London, near St Paul's Cathedral.
